Lecturer/Senior Lecturer in Film/TV Studies 

As part of a major development of Film and TV Studies at the University of 
Birmingham, the Department of American and Canadian Studies is seeking 
to appoint a Lecturer/Senior Lecturer in Film and TV Studies. 

You will add to the research and teaching strengths of the department and 
forge links with other departments in the University and institutions
outside 
it. You will currently be working in any area of Film and TV Studies
although 
an interest in American Film/TV Studies and/or Documentary would be 
an advantage. 

Lecturer - Starting salary £32,795 - £39,160 a year (potential
progression on performance once in post to £44,074 a year).

Senior Lecturer - Starting salary £40,335 - £46,758 a year (potential
progression on performance once in post to £49,607 a year).
